2013 RBC Canadian Open prize money

Brandt Snedeker won the 2013 RBC Canadian Open on 28 July 2013 and took $1,008,000. Below is every one of the 68 cheques paid that week, in finishing order, down to the $10,416 Ryo Ishikawa collected for finishing 77.

Every player paid at the 2013 RBC Canadian Open, in finishing order, with the country played for, the score and the cheque.
PLACE PLAYER COUNTRY TO PAR TOTAL PRIZE MONEY
1 Brandt Snedeker USA -16 272 $1,008,000
T2 Dustin Johnson USA -13 275 $369,600
T2 Jason Bohn USA -13 275 $369,600
T2 Matt Kuchar USA -13 275 $369,600
T2 William McGirt USA -13 275 $369,600
T6 John Merrick USA -12 276 $187,600
T6 Mark Wilson USA -12 276 $187,600
T6 Roberto Castro USA -12 276 $187,600
T9 Aaron Baddeley AUS -11 277 $151,200
T9 Jim Furyk USA -11 277 $151,200
T9 Patrick Reed USA -11 277 $151,200
T12 David Lingmerth SWE -10 278 $113,400
T12 Greg Owen ENG -10 278 $113,400
T12 Kyle Stanley USA -10 278 $113,400
T12 Rory Sabbatini SVK -10 278 $113,400
T16 Chad Campbell USA -9 279 $84,000
T16 Charley Hoffman USA -9 279 $84,000
T16 Fabián Gómez ARG -9 279 $84,000
T16 Hideki Matsuyama JPN -9 279 $84,000
T16 Marcel Siem GER -9 279 $84,000
T21 Andres Romero ARG -8 280 $54,160
T21 Bubba Watson USA -8 280 $54,160
T21 Chris Kirk USA -8 280 $54,160
T21 Ernie Els RSA -8 280 $54,160
T21 James Driscoll USA -8 280 $54,160
T21 Luke List USA -8 280 $54,160
T21 Trevor Immelman RSA -8 280 $54,160
T28 Charl Schwartzel RSA -7 281 $39,760
T28 Matt Every USA -7 281 $39,760
T28 Nicholas Thompson USA -7 281 $39,760
T31 Chez Reavie USA -6 282 $30,427
T31 Jason Kokrak USA -6 282 $30,427
T31 J.J. Henry USA -6 282 $30,427
T31 Ryan Palmer USA -6 282 $30,427
T31 Sangmoon Bae KOR -6 282 $30,427
T31 Stuart Appleby AUS -6 282 $30,427
T31 Vijay Singh FIJ -6 282 $30,427
T40 Greg Chalmers AUS -5 283 $22,400
T40 James Hahn USA -5 283 $22,400
T44 Cameron Percy AUS -4 284 $17,405
T44 Cameron Tringale USA -4 284 $17,405
T44 David Hearn CAN -4 284 $17,405
T44 Justin Leonard USA -4 284 $17,405
T44 Richard Lee USA -4 284 $17,405
T49 Andrew Svoboda USA -3 285 $14,149
T49 Mike Weir CAN -3 285 $14,149
T52 Bob Estes USA -2 286 $12,805
T52 Cameron Beckman USA -2 286 $12,805
T52 Camilo Villegas COL -2 286 $12,805
T52 Casey Wittenberg USA -2 286 $12,805
T52 Morgan Hoffmann USA -2 286 $12,805
T52 Roger Sloan CAN -2 286 $12,805
T52 Scott Langley USA -2 286 $12,805
T52 Scott Piercy USA -2 286 $12,805
T52 Tommy Gainey USA -2 286 $12,805
T61 Gary Woodland USA -1 287 $11,984
T61 Robert Allenby AUS -1 287 $11,984
T61 Scott Brown USA -1 287 $11,984
T66 Y.E. Yang KOR 0 288 $11,592
T68 Billy Horschel USA 1 289 $11,256
T68 Brendan Steele USA 1 289 $11,256
T68 Kevin Chappell USA 1 289 $11,256
T68 Tim Petrovic USA 1 289 $11,256
73 Brian Gay USA 4 292 $10,864
74 Graeme McDowell NIR 1 217 $10,752
T75 Brian Stuard USA 2 218 $10,584
T75 Seung-Yul Noh KOR 2 218 $10,584
77 Ryo Ishikawa JPN 7 223 $10,416

The top of the ladder

The fifteen biggest cheques of the week took $3,956,400 between them, against $1,552,525 shared by the other 53 players paid.

The 68 cheques above come to $5,508,925 between them. We hold 111 players for the week in all, so 43 of them took no money: a missed cut, a withdrawal or an amateur place. A place written as T4 is a tie, and everyone tied for it was paid the same.
